Averyrose Girl
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: AY-vree-rose //ˈeɪ.vri.roʊz//
Origin: English; French
Meaning: Averyrose combines 'Avery' meaning 'ruler of the elves' (English) and 'rose' symbolizing love and beauty (French).
Historical & Cultural Background
The name Averyrose is a modern compound name that combines the elements "Avery" and "rose." The name Avery has its roots in the Old English name "Aelfric," which means "elf ruler." This name evolved through various forms, including the Old French "Averi" and Middle English "Avery," before being adopted into contemporary English usage. The name rose, on the other hand, derives from the Latin word "rosa," which has been used in various languages to denote the flower, symbolizing beauty and love.
The combination of these two elements into Averyrose reflects a blending of historical and floral significance, often associated with femininity and grace. Historically, the name Avery has been used since the Middle Ages, gaining popularity in England and later in America.
It was borne by notable figures, including Avery Brown, a 17th-century English settler in America. The rose, as a symbol, has been prominent in literature and art throughout history, often representing love and beauty.
The use of floral names has been a common practice in various cultures, with roses frequently appearing in poetry and religious texts, including the works of Shakespeare and in Christian symbolism. The cultural resonance of Averyrose lies in its evocation of both strength and delicacy.
The name embodies the characteristics associated with its components: the strength of a ruler and the beauty of a rose. This duality has made it appealing in various contexts, from literature to personal naming traditions.
The name also lends itself to diminutive forms, such as "Avery" or "Rose," which have their own historical significance and usage. Overall, Averyrose represents a harmonious blend of historical roots and cultural symbolism, reflecting a rich tapestry of linguistic and cultural heritage.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Averyrose was first seen in the United States in 2015.
Averyrose has ranked as high as #1381 nationally, which occurred in 2015, and has been most popular in California.
In the past 5 years the name Averyrose has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.
